Lagoon for SNES


Image: MobyGames

Lagoon

Zelda with a butter knife


Genre: adventure - overhead

Publisher: Kemko/Seika

Year: 1992

System: SNES


Gameplay Score: 2

Gameplay Notes:

Miniscule 10% draw distance Weapon has an insanely short reach. Enemies hit you as often as you can attack them. They also love to stun lock you since you have no i-frames. You start with a comically small amount of health. Be prepared to die A LOT early on. Enemies move randomly so they're extremely hard to hit. 4 way directional movement. Very slow movement.


Level Design Score: 3

Level Design Notes:

Typical dungeon design, but at least there are some recognizable features that help you navigate the maze. Not great but not bad either.


Theme Score: 3

Theme Notes:

Very generic fantasy/JRPG setting. It's simple enough that I can dig it.


Art Style Score: 3

Art Style Notes:

Lots of slowdown. Simple but attractive graphics.


Audio Score: 4

Audio Notes:

Love the music in this game! Even though the game itself is pretty awful, I felt compelled to continue playing. I credit the music. Lots of sound effects get swallowed for some reason.


Overall Score: 52
